Obverse description Detailed architectural relief of Al-Masjid An-Nabawi (the Prophet's Mosque) in Medina, featuring the central green dome flanked by multiple minarets, with a mirror-polished field in the background. Two lines of Arabic calligraphic legend appear in the upper portion of the field above the mosque facade.
Obverse script Log in to see details
Obverse lettering المدينة المنورة المسجد النبوي الشريف
(Translation: Medina (The Radiant City) Honorable Al-Masjid An-Nabawi (Prophet`s Mosque))
Reverse description Large Arabic calligraphic legend in the central field against a mirror-polished background, with a decorative geometric and floral border in relief encircling the inner field. The name of the Prophet Muhammad appears prominently in the upper centre, with additional text below.
